A familiar face is coming to Law and Order SVU for Season 16. Peter Gallagher is joining the cast of the NBC show.

E! News reported Friday that the actor will be joining the show in a recurring role. Gallagher will be playing Deputy Chief William Dodds. He is reportedly "charismatic" and the "tough-as-nails" boss of all special victims units in New York City. He will also be Olivia Benson's (Mariska Hargitay) boss.

Dodds demands respect and hard work from all those who work for him.

"I've wanted to write for and work with Peter Gallagher since...forever. He's an actor's actor-deft with text and subtext; emotion and intellect," executive producer Warren Leight said about the role. "Like everyone else in our cast, he's also a great singer. We're all thrilled that this long into the show's run, actors of his quality want to do an arc on SVU."

Gallagher has been on Covert Affairs and The O.C. most recently. TVLine also revealed in August that Today Show host Hoda Kotb along with Ron Rifkin and Brian D'Arcy James will also guest star this season on the show.

Hargitay, it was revealed, will also be a producer on the hit NBC show after 16 years of acting on it.

Law & Order: SVU is set to premiere Wednesday, September 24 at 9 p.m. ET on NBC.
